四、 HTTP消息(HTTP message)
1. 消息類型——HTTP-message = Request | Response ; HTTP/1.1 messages
generic-message = start-line *(message-header CRLF) CRLF [ message-body ]
start-line = Request-Line | Status-Line
2. 消息頭——HTTP頭域包括常規(guī)頭,請(qǐng)求頭,應(yīng)答頭和實(shí)體頭域
message-header = field-name ":" [ field-value ]
field-name = token
field-value = *( field-content | LWS )
field-content
= <the OCTETs making up the field-value and consisting of either
*TEXT or combinations of token, separators, and quoted-string>
3. 消息體——message-body = entity-body| <entity-body encoded as per Transfer-Encoding>
4. 消息的長(zhǎng)度——決定因素
5. 常規(guī)頭域——general-header = Cache-Control| Connection| Date| Pragma| Transfer-Encoding
五、 請(qǐng)求(request)
首行包括利用資源的方式,區(qū)分資源的標(biāo)識(shí),以及協(xié)議的版本號(hào)
Request = Request-Line * (( general-header| request-header| entity-header ) CRLF) CRLF [ message-body ]
1. 請(qǐng)求行——Request-Line = Method SP Request-URI SP HTTP-Version CRLF
方法——方法標(biāo)記指的是在請(qǐng)求URI所指定的資源上所實(shí)現(xiàn)的方式
Method = "OPTIONS"| "GET"| "POST"| "PUT"| "DELETE"| "TRACE"| "CONNECT"| extension-method
extension-method = token
請(qǐng)求URL——請(qǐng)求URL是一種全球統(tǒng)一的應(yīng)用于資源請(qǐng)求的資源標(biāo)識(shí)符
Request-URI = "*" | absoluteURI | abs_path | authority
請(qǐng)求行舉例:GET http://www.w3.org/pub/WWW/TheProject.html HTTP/1.1
GET /pub/WWW/TheProject.html HTTP/1.1
Host: www.w3.org
2. 請(qǐng)求定義的資源——一個(gè)INTERNET請(qǐng)求所定義的精確資源由請(qǐng)求URL和主機(jī)報(bào)頭域所決定
3. 請(qǐng)求報(bào)頭域——request-header = Accept| Accept-Charset|
Accept-Encoding| Accept-Language| Authorization| Expect| From| Host|
If-Match| If-Modified-Since| If-None-Match| If-Range|
If-Unmodified-Since| Max-Forwards| Proxy-Authorization| Range| Referer|
TE| User-Agent
六、 應(yīng)答(response)
接收和翻譯一個(gè)請(qǐng)求信息后,服務(wù)器發(fā)出一個(gè)HTTP應(yīng)答信息
Response = Status-Line*(( general-header| response-header| entity-header ) CRLF) CRLF [ message-body ]
1. 狀態(tài)行——Status-Line = HTTP-Version SP Status-Code SP Reason-Phrase CRLF
狀態(tài)碼——狀態(tài)碼是試圖理解和滿足請(qǐng)求的三位數(shù)字的整數(shù)碼,1xx,2xx,3xx,4xx,5xx,100-〉505-〉擴(kuò)展碼
2. 應(yīng)答報(bào)頭域——response-header = Accept-Ranges| Age| Location| Proxy-Authenticate| Retry-After| Server| Vary| WWW-Authenticate
七、 實(shí)體(entity)
在未經(jīng)特別規(guī)定的情況下,請(qǐng)求與應(yīng)答的消息也可以傳送實(shí)體。 實(shí)體包括實(shí)體報(bào)頭域與實(shí)體正文,而有些應(yīng)答只包括實(shí)體報(bào)頭。
1. 實(shí)體報(bào)頭域——entity-header = Allow | Content-Encoding|
Content-Language| Content-Length | Content-Location| Content-MD5|
Content-Range| Content-Type| Expires| Last-Modified| extension-header
extension-header = message-header
2. 實(shí)體正文——entity-body = *OCTET
entity-body := Content-Encoding( Content-Type( data ) )

九、 方法定義(method definitions)
1. 安全和等冪方法
安全方法——GET和HEAD方法除了補(bǔ)救外不應(yīng)該有別的采取措施的含義
等冪方法——沒(méi)有副作用的序列是等冪的
2. OPTIONS——OPTIONS方法代表在請(qǐng)求URI確定的請(qǐng)求/應(yīng)答過(guò)程中通信條件是否可行的信息
3. GET——GET方法說(shuō)明了重建信息的內(nèi)容由請(qǐng)求URI來(lái)確定
4. HEAD——除了應(yīng)答中禁止返回消息正文外,HEAD方法與GET方法一樣
5. POST——POST方法實(shí)現(xiàn)的實(shí)際功能取決于服務(wù)器
6. PUT——PUT方法要求所附實(shí)體存儲(chǔ)在提供的請(qǐng)求URI下
7. DELETE——DELELE方法要求原服務(wù)器釋放請(qǐng)求URI指向的資源
8. TRACE——TRACE方法用于調(diào)用遠(yuǎn)程的應(yīng)用層循環(huán)請(qǐng)求消息
9. CONNECT——CONNECT方法用于能動(dòng)態(tài)建立起隧道的代理服務(wù)器

十四、 報(bào)頭域定義(header field definitions)
1. Accept——Accept = "Accept" ":" #( media-range [ accept-params ] )
media-range = ( "*/*"| ( type "/" "*" )| ( type "/" subtype )) *( ";" parameter )
accept-params = ";" "q" "=" qvalue *( accept-extension )
accept-extension = ";" token [ "=" ( token | quoted-string ) ]
例1:Accept: audio/*; q=0.2, audio/basic
例2:Accept: text/plain; q=0.5, text/html, text/x-dvi; q=0.8, text/x-c
2. Accept-Charset——Accept-Charset = "Accept-Charset" ":" 1#( ( charset | "*" )[ ";" "q" "=" qvalue ] )
例:Accept-Charset: iso-8859-5, unicode-1-1;q=0.8
3. Accept-Encoding——Accept-Encoding = "Accept-Encoding" ":" 1#( codings [ ";" "q" "=" qvalue ] )
codings = ( content-coding | "*" )
例:Accept-Encoding: gzip;q=1.0, identity; q=0.5, *;q=0
4. Accept-Language——Accept-Language = "Accept-Language" ":" 1#( language-range [ ";" "q" "=" qvalue ] )
language-range = ( ( 1*8ALPHA *( "-" 1*8ALPHA ) ) | "*" )
例:Accept-Language: da, en-gb;q=0.8, en;q=0.7
5. Accept-Range——Accept-Ranges = "Accept-Ranges" ":" acceptable-ranges
acceptable-ranges = 1#range-unit | "none"
例:Accept-Ranges: bytes
6. Age——Age = "Age" ":" age-value
age-value = delta-seconds
7. Allow——Allow = "Allow" ":" #Method
例:Allow: GET, HEAD, PUT
8. Authorization——Authorization = "Authorization" ":" credentials
9. Cache-Control——Cache-Control = "Cache-Control" ":" 1#cache-directive
cache-directive = cache-request-directive| cache-response-directive
cache-request-directive
="no-cache"| "no-store"| "max-age" "=" delta-seconds| "max-stale" [ "="
delta-seconds ]| "min-fresh" "=" delta-seconds| "no-transform"|
"only-if-cached"| cache-extension
cache-response-directive
="public"| "private" [ "=" <"> 1#field-name <"> ]|
"no-cache" [ "=" <"> 1#field-name <"> ]| "no-store"|
"no-transform"| "must-revalidate"| "proxy-revalidate"| "max-age" "="
delta-seconds| "s-maxage" "=" delta-seconds| cache-extension
cache-extension = token [ "=" ( token | quoted-string ) ]

10. Connection——Connection = "Connection" ":" 1#(connection-token)
connection-token = token
例:Connection: close
11. Content-Encoding——Content-Encoding = "Content-Encoding" ":" 1#content-coding
例:Content-Encoding: gzip
12. Content-Language——Content-Language = "Content-Language" ":" 1#language-tag
例:Content-Language: mi, en
13. Content-Length——Content-Length = "Content-Length" ":" 1*DIGIT
Content-Length: 3495
14. Content-Location——Content-Location = "Content-Location" ":"( absoluteURI | relativeURI )
15. Content-MD5——Content-MD5 = "Content-MD5" ":" md5-digest
md5-digest = <base64 of 128 bit MD5 digest as per RFC 1864>
16. Content-Range——Content-Range = "Content-Range" ":" content-range-spec
content-range-spec = byte-content-range-spec
byte-content-range-spec = bytes-unit SP byte-range-resp-spec "/"( instance-length | "*" )
byte-range-resp-spec = (first-byte-pos "-" last-byte-pos) | "*"
instance-length = 1*DIGIT
例:The first 500 bytes:bytes 0-499/1234
17. Content-Type——Content-Type = "Content-Type" ":" media-type
例:Content-Type: text/html; charset=ISO-8859-4
18. Date——Date = "Date" ":" HTTP-date
例:Date: Tue, 15 Nov 1994 08:12:31 GMT
沒(méi)有時(shí)鐘的原服務(wù)器的運(yùn)作
19. Etag——ETag = "ETag" ":" entity-tag
例:ETag: W/"xyzzy"
20. Expect——Expect = "Expect" ":" 1#expectation
expectation = "100-continue" | expectation-extension
expectation-extension = token [ "=" ( token | quoted-string )*expect-params ]
expect-params = ";" token [ "=" ( token | quoted-string ) ]
21. Expires——Expires = "Expires" ":" HTTP-date
例:Expires: Thu, 01 Dec 1994 16:00:00 GMT
22. From——From = "From" ":" mailbox
例:From: webmaster@w3.org
23. Host——Host = "Host" ":" host [ ":" port ] ; Section 3.2.2
24. If-Match——If-Match = "If-Match" ":" ( "*" | 1#entity-tag )
例:If-Match: "xyzzy", "r2d2xxxx", "c3piozzzz"
25. If-Modified-Since——If-Modified-Since = "If-Modified-Since" ":" HTTP-date
例:If-Modified-Since: Sat, 29 Oct 1994 19:43:31 GMT
26. If-None-Match ——If-None-Match = "If-None-Match" ":" ( "*" | 1#entity-tag )
例:If-None-Match: W/"xyzzy", W/"r2d2xxxx", W/"c3piozzzz"
27. If-Range ——If-Range = "If-Range" ":" ( entity-tag | HTTP-date )
28. If-Unmodified-Since ——If-Unmodified-Since = "If-Unmodified-Since" ":" HTTP-date
例:If-Unmodified-Since: Sat, 29 Oct 1994 19:43:31 GMT
29. Last-Modified ——Last-Modified = "Last-Modified" ":" HTTP-date
例:Last-Modified: Tue, 15 Nov 1994 12:45:26 GMT
30. Location ——Location = "Location" ":" absoluteURI
Location: http://www.w3.org/pub/WWW/People.html
31. Max-Forwards ——Max-Forwards = "Max-Forwards" ":" 1*DIGIT
32. Pragma ——Pragma = "Pragma" ":" 1#pragma-directive
pragma-directive = "no-cache" | extension-pragma
extension-pragma = token [ "=" ( token | quoted-string ) ]
33. Proxy-Authenticate ——Proxy-Authenticate = "Proxy-Authenticate" ":" 1#challenge
34. Proxy-Authorization ——Proxy-Authorization = "Proxy-Authorization" ":" credentials
35. Range——字節(jié)范圍
范圍檢索請(qǐng)求
Range = "Range" ":" ranges-specifier
36. Referer——Referer = "Referer" ":" ( absoluteURI | relativeURI )
37. Retry-After ——Retry-After = "Retry-After" ":" ( HTTP-date | delta-seconds )
38. Server ——Server = "Server" ":" 1*( product | comment )
39. TE ——TE = "TE" ":" #( t-codings )
t-codings = "trailers" | ( transfer-extension [ accept-params ] )
例:TE: trailers, deflate;q=0.5
40. Trailer ——Trailer = "Trailer" ":" 1#field-name
41. Transfer-Encoding ——Transfer-Encoding = "Transfer-Encoding" ":" 1#transfer-coding
例:Transfer-Encoding: chunked
42. Upgrade——Upgrade = "Upgrade" ":" 1#product
例:Upgrade: HTTP/2.0, SHTTP/1.3, IRC/6.9, RTA/x11
43. User-Agent ——User-Agent = "User-Agent" ":" 1*( product | comment )
例:User-Agent: CERN-LineMode/2.15 libwww/2.17b3
44. Vary ——Vary = "Vary" ":" ( "*" | 1#field-name )
45. Via ——Via = "Via" ":" 1#( received-protocol received-by [ comment ] )
received-protocol = [ protocol-name "/" ] protocol-version
protocol-name = token
protocol-version = token
received-by = ( host [ ":" port ] ) | pseudonym
pseudonym = token
例:Via: 1.0 ricky, 1.1 ethel, 1.1 fred, 1.0 lucy
46. Warning = "Warning" ":" 1#warning-value
warning-value = warn-code SP warn-agent SP warn-text [SP warn-date]
warn-code = 3DIGIT
warn-agent = ( host [ ":" port ] ) | pseudonym
warn-text = quoted-string
warn-date = <"> HTTP-date <">
47. WWW-Authenticate ——WWW-Authenticate = "WWW-Authenticate" ":" 1#challenge
